MOM'S Home-Delivered Meals:
GCPH has been using MOM'S Meals to help meet the nutritional needs of home-bound seniors since 2018. MOM'S Meals delivers medically tailored, ready-to-heat refrigerated meals. The meals are crafted by chefs and registered dietitians to both taste great while nutritionally supporting common chronic conditions. The County pays for four meals per week (up to 16 per month) for lower-income individuals age 60 and over. Individuals can also purchase additional meals.
